Let \(G\) be a plane graph. The \(Z\)-transformation graph \(Z(G)\) of \(G\) is the graph whose vertices are the perfect matchings of \(G\) with two vertices being adjacent if and only if the symmetric difference of the corresponding perfect matchings consists of the boundary of a single finite face of \(G\). The author discusses some properties of polyominoes with perfect matchings. In particular, he proves that outside of two exceptional cases the connectivity of the \(Z\)-transformation graph of a polyomino with perfect matchings has connectivity equal to its minimum degree.
